What we don't claim

Our detector catches text that reads like an unedited AI draft, and explains every flag. It does not reliably catch AI text that was prompted casually or run through a humanizer — and our testing says nothing affordable does. So a clean scan is reported as exactly that: no AI-draft signals found — not proof of human authorship. If a detection tool tells you otherwise, ask to see the curve.

How accurate is the AI detector?

We publish curves, not confidence: 0.87 AUC catching unedited AI drafts, a 1% false-positive budget on human writing set by design, and a full public writeup of what evades detection — including casually-styled and humanized AI text, which our testing shows defeats every method in this category. Every number comes from our evaluation runs, re-run monthly.

Will it falsely accuse a human writer?

It is built so that the cost of caution falls on the catch rate, never on the writer. At our threshold, at most 1% of human documents flag by design, accusatory verdicts require high combined evidence, templated or formal writing gets structural protection, and in our tests real non-native-English writing produced zero false flags.

Does a clean result prove a document is human-written?

No, and we say so on every scan. A clean result means no AI-draft signals were found — current-generation AI told to write casually can evade detection. Any tool claiming otherwise should show you the measurement.
